Latest Patents

Weixiang Jin's latest patents include a bleeder current control circuit and a voltage converting circuit. The bleeder current control method involves several steps, including the transmission of a post-bridge input signal to the power system. A shaping circuit then processes this signal into a bleeder current reference signal, which is inversely correlated with the initial input signal. By acquiring a current sampling signal and comparing it with the reference signal, an error signal is generated. This allows for the control of the current sampling signal, ensuring that it aligns with the waveform of the bleeder current reference signal. This method aims to provide a reliable sine wave envelope signal to the power system, thereby reducing losses caused by bleeder current.

The second patent focuses on a non-isolating AC-DC voltage converting system that utilizes two voltage converters. The first converter activates a power transistor when the bus voltage is at its lowest, providing an interim voltage that is lower than the bus voltage. The second converter then takes this interim voltage to deliver the output voltage for the AC-DC voltage converting system.
